Job description

Are you passionate about supporting leaders from around the world? Do you thrive on creating transformative learning experiences and building international networks? We're looking for a Global Fellowship Manager to join our London-based team to manage a high-profile international fellowship programme within a collaborative team, working with global cities, cultural leaders and partners from six continents. 

The Global Fellowship is the first of its kind. It will grow civic leadership and support future generations of cultural policy leaders who are responsible for managing complex projects, networks and cultural ecosystems.

You'll manage this pioneering programme and be instrumental in shaping the future of global cultural leadership as part of our small and dedicated team. 

Location: Hybrid. In London office at least 3 days per week plus when meetings required. Flexibility for remote work and some international travel. 

Reports To: Senior Programme and Research Manager 

Employment Type: 12-month fixed term, full-time (37.5 hours/week). We will also consider 0.8 FTE or secondment arrangements 

Salary: £40,000 per annum 

Application Deadline: 04 March 2026 at 09:00 GMT
